Portrait of Robert Dudley, Earl of Leicester, whole length, standing to right on a platform, wearing plumed hat, lace-trimmed ruff, armour, chain, hose, boots and stirrups, holding a staff in his right hand, his left hand on hilt of sword; helmet, shield and crown at his feet; naval battle below in background; wood-engraved border to sheet; letterpress below image and on verso; illustration to an unidentified Dutch publication.
Engraving, wood-engraving and letterpress
